MarketAxess Reports Q4 Earnings
Bond trading platform operator posts revenue and earnings results.
Feb. 6, 2026 at 6:15am
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
MarketAxess Holdings Inc., the operator of bond trading platforms, reported fourth-quarter net income of $92.2 million, or $2.51 per share. Adjusted earnings were $1.68 per share, topping Wall Street expectations. The company posted revenue of $209.4 million in the quarter, which fell short of analyst forecasts.
Why it matters
As a leading electronic trading platform for fixed-income securities, MarketAxess' quarterly results provide insight into the overall health of the bond trading industry and investor sentiment. The company's performance is closely watched by analysts and investors as an indicator of broader market trends.
The details
MarketAxess reported Q4 earnings that exceeded analyst estimates, though its revenue fell short of forecasts. The company attributed its strong earnings to higher trading volumes and improved operational efficiency. However, the lower-than-expected revenue suggests some potential headwinds in the fixed-income market.
- MarketAxess reported its Q4 2025 results on February 6, 2026.
The players
MarketAxess Holdings Inc.
An electronic trading platform for fixed-income securities, headquartered in New York City.
The takeaway
MarketAxess' strong earnings but weaker revenue point to a mixed picture for the bond trading industry, with potential challenges ahead even as the company continues to perform well overall.
